WATCH: Moment When Lok Sabha Security Was Breached On Parliament Attack Anniversary

On the 22nd anniversary of the Parliament attack, an unidentified man jumped from the visitor's gallery of Lok Sabha after which the House was adjourned.

Lok Sabha Security Breach: An unidentified man jumped from the visitor's gallery of Lok Sabha after which there was a slight commotion and the House was adjourned. The security breach in the lower hose comes on the 22nd anniversary of the Parliament attack.

Two people jumped down from the audience gallery and hurled gas cannisters. Congress leader Adhir Ranjan Chowdhury said two persons jumped from the public gallery into Lok Sabha chamber and were overpowered by members. It is pertinent to mention that there has been no official statement issued by the Central government in connection with the incident.  

Speaking on the breach, Congress MP Karti Chidambaram said, "Suddenly two young men around 20 years old jumped into the House from the visitor's gallery and had canisters in their hand. These canisters were emitting yellow smoke. One of them was attempting to run towards the Speaker's chair. They were shouting some slogans. The smoke could have been poisonous. This is a serious breach of security especially on 13th December, the day when Parliament was attacked in 2001..."

Lok Sabha speaker Om Birla said, "A thorough investigation of the incident that took place during zero hour, is being done. Essential instructions have also been given to Delhi Police. In the primary investigation, it has been found that it was just a smoke and there is no need to worry about the smoke."

Om Birla said both the accused have been held. He said, "Both of them have been nabbed and the materials with them have also been seized. The two people outside the Parliament have also been arrested by Police."
